2. Effects of WR and HRWR on fresh concrete Water reduction. WR and HRWP can be used to decrease water, decrease water per cement ratio (W/C). It is resulted in increasing strength with same workability. If W/C is fixed, the workability is increased. Another affects from water reduction is to reduce cement content while workability keep ...
Aggregates form the major part of concrete and are derived from many types of rock. Granite and limestone are extracted from quarries, crushed and graded. In many parts of the UK, landbased or marine sand and gravel are available: these require some processing, such as washing and grading, before use in concrete.

UV damage and sun exposure, the hidden danger. While you may think your house, decks or concrete areas are safe with just a waterproof sealant, they aren't. Harsh UV rays damage both wood, masonry and concrete surfaces over time. In areas with a long photoperiod (length of sunshine per day) over the summer months, UV damage is accelerated.

Concrete materials such as cement, sand, aggregates, and other admixtures play an important role in maintaining the airvoid system in concrete. It has been found that air content will increase as cement alkali levels increase (Pomeroy 1989; Whiting 1983) and decrease as cement fineness increases significantly (ACI Comm. 212 1963).
